Hordorf is a village in the municipality of Cremlingen in the Wolfenbüttel district in Lower Saxony .

geography

Hordorf is the northernmost village in the municipality of Cremlingen. The district of Hordorf is bordered by Schandelah and Weddel in the south, Schapen and Dibbesdorf in the west, Essehof and the state forest teaching in the north and the Bundeswehr training area in the east.

The total area of ​​Hordorf is 5.87 km². Hordorf has 1,071 inhabitants (December 31, 2017) and thus a population density of 182 inhabitants per km².

history

Hordorf was first mentioned in a document from Bruno von Brunsrode in 1299 as Hordorpe . Due to the ending -dorf, it can be assumed that it was founded between 500 and 800 AD. In addition to the spelling Hordorpe, there is also Hordorp (1334), Hoddope (1374), Hordorpf (1575) and Hortorf (1654).

The name Hordorf is derived from the Old High German word hora for swamp. There used to be many ponds and wetlands in the Hordorf area.

On March 1, 1974, Hordorf was incorporated into the municipality of Cremlingen.

politics

Local council

The local council of Hordorf has nine seats, four of which are occupied by the CDU , four by the SPD and one by the Independent Voting Association (UWG) .

The local mayor is Reinhold Briel (as of 2019).

coat of arms

The coat of arms of Hordorf has existed since 1984. It is divided and shows three blue cattails above in gold . In the base of the shield there is a golden swivel plow in blue . As can be seen from the place name, Hordorf is located in a swampy environment (ahd. Hora , swamp), which is indicated by the cattails in the coat of arms. The swivel plow in the shield foot refers to the fact that Hordorf was a typical farming village.
